Suzuki Intruder C800B Weight (611lb)

Quick answer

For the 2014 model year, the Suzuki Intruder C800B motorcycle has a listed wet/running weight of 610.7 lb (277 kg).

Wet / running weight610.7 lb (277 kg)
Fuel capacity4.09 US gal (15.5 L)
Full tank fuel weight25.5 lb (11.5 kg)

Suzuki Intruder C800B weight & related specs

Model years covered 2014
Wet / running weight 610.7 lb (277 kg)
Engine displacement 805 cc
Torque 50.9 lb-ft (69 Nm)
Fuel capacity 4.09 US gal (15.5 L)
Full-tank fuel weight (estimated) 25.5 lb (11.5 kg)

Useful weight calculations

Torque per 100 lb 8.33 lb-ft / 100 lb
Displacement per pound 1.32 cc / lb
Weight per 100 cc 75.9 lb / 100 cc
Fuel weight as % of bike weight 4.2%

Suzuki Intruder C800B weight FAQ

How heavy is the Suzuki Intruder C800B ready to ride?

Listed ready-to-ride weight is 610.7 lb (277 kg).

Is the Suzuki Intruder C800B heavy compared with other Suzuki custom/cruiser motorcycles?

It sits fairly close to the middle of the category. Its representative wet weight is around the 54th percentile among 54 compatible Suzuki custom/cruiser motorcycles.

How much does the Suzuki Intruder C800B fuel weigh?

The listed tank capacity is 4.09 US gal (15.5 L). Using approximately 0.745 kg/L gasoline, a full tank is roughly 25.5 lb (11.5 kg). That is an estimate for fuel mass, not an official Suzuki curb-weight calculation.

How heavy is the Suzuki Intruder C800B with an average-size rider?

A 180 lb rider brings the simple bike-plus-rider total to roughly 790.7 lb (358.6 kg) using the representative wet/running figure. Gear and luggage would add more.

How much torque does the Suzuki Intruder C800B have per 100 lb?

The calculated torque-to-weight range is 8.33 lb-ft per 100 lb. It is useful for comparing bikes with very different overall weights.

What is the Suzuki Intruder C800B displacement per pound?

Engine displacement relative to bike weight is 1.32 cc per lb. It can help compare motorcycles from very different displacement classes without relying on cc alone.

What is the Suzuki Intruder C800B weight difference versus the category median?

The model sits about 8.8 lb (4 kg) heavier than the compatible median Suzuki custom/cruiser motorcycle weight used on this page.
